Overview

This year’s National NAIDOC Week marks 50 years of the week-long celebrations, and the theme, The Next Generation: Strength, Vision & Legacy, celebrates achievements of the past and the bright future ahead.

Be a part of honouring and elevating Aboriginal voices, culture and resilience as you learn about weaving techniques and create your own bracelet to take home.

4 drop-in sessions available throughout the day starting on the hour from 10.00am.

No bookings necessary. Please drop in and enjoy learning about Aboriginal crafts and culture.

Free family event.
